The position

Job description

As a Project Manager, you will be the main point of contact for some key clients in Europe and will be responsible for the following:

Global project roll-out and run phases coordination

  • Create positive project outcomes by managing commitments, expectations, and timelines, regardless of project status or types of deliveries (software or research), so that client stakeholders feel continually informed and empowered.
  • Coordinate the roll-out of our software platform between internal stakeholders, customers, and key partners worldwide, while staying on timeline (or effectively communicating changes to timeline if parties agree and are supportive).
  • Manage projects by breaking them into distinct actions with single owners, composed of dependencies and deliverables, while updating and reporting on actions to all stakeholders.
  • Set-up and maintain governance processes and framework, and ensure these are accessible and create handrails as well as documented paper trails.
  • Organize knowledge management and share best practices internally.
  • Implement, manage, and maintain project management tools and processes.
  • Ensure consistency at global, regional, and local levels.
  • Facilitate up sell and cross sell opportunities in support of the account management team.
  • Liaise with our Product team on roadmap questions and feature requests.

Customer care and communication

  • Develop a relationship of trust with multiple stakeholders and client teams.
  • Ensure operational Day-to-day interactions with clients.
  • Provide regular status updates to your clients.
  • Address any urgent questions or last-minute requests in a timely manner.

Social Intelligence adoption program ownership

  • Ensure overall long- term client satisfaction and project success, contributing to the expansion of our social intelligence program.
  • Monitor the adoption and usage of our solutions across client teams.
  • Contribute to various evangelization initiatives (workshops, events, internal pitch) and develop specific content to raise awareness about your program.
  • Contribute to the client user community extension
  • Set a continuous improvement mindset on our social intelligence technologies, ensure social intelligence is fully integrated into client’s digital ecosystem, ensure social intelligence as a go-to-source in strategic decision making for clients

Preferred experience

  • At least 2 years of project management preferably in digital agencies or consulting firm
  • Experience with monitoring platforms, market research, web analytics or BI tool
  • Fluent in English and French is mandatory. A third language is a plus.
  • Outstanding communications and presentation skills. Your insights and presentations provoke debate and compel action with a non-academic, accessible style
  • Strong organizational skills. Comfortable with fast pace environment and able to prioritize
  • High level of autonomy and decision making capabilities. Ability to manage complex projects.
  • Ability to interact with both operational and C-Level contacts.
  • Strong interpersonal skills. Comfortable working closely with Consumer Insights, Digital Marketing, PR and Corporate Communication divisions.
  • Efficient working knowledge of Microsoft Office and Google Suite
  • Expertise in the Wine & Spirit, luxury, telecom, banking or food industries is a plus.
  • PMP, PRINCE II or Microsoft Project certification is a plus.
